"The Lincoln Train" is an alternate histor … "The Lincoln Train" is an alternate history short story published by Maureen F. McHugh, published in April 1995. It is collected in volume 31 of the Nebula Awards anthologies, in Alternate Tyrants (1997), and in Best of the Best: 20 Years of the Year's Best Science Fiction (2005).of the Year's Best Science Fiction (2005).
, Il treno di Lincoln (The Lincoln Train) è … Il treno di Lincoln (The Lincoln Train) è un racconto breve di fantascienza ucronica del 1995 scritto da Maureen F. McHugh. L'opera ha vinto nel 1996 il Premio Hugo per il miglior racconto breve e il Premio Locus per il miglior racconto breve; nel 1995 era stata anche candidata al Premio Nebula per il miglior racconto breve. Nella sua lettera che accompagna il racconto nel volume 31 della raccolta Nebula Awards, Maureen McHugh afferma che originariamente intendeva scrivere una storia dal punto di vista di Lincoln, ma dopo aver letto i suoi discorsi e le sue lettere, si è sentita incapace di "catturare l'uomo sulla carta" e così lo ha tenuto "dietro le quinte".a" e così lo ha tenuto "dietro le quinte".
